Output 6f17827d530a493a70c0989c89319e719c8b579e57dac86ca94cf52dd059dc6a:4

value
16166652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d433ef6ba91087101241bef9f39b1bf2588e3ab OP_EQUAL
address
MLn64osa8woqnj6xCtx9EmDkJNHW5EZE51
transaction
6f17827d530a493a70c0989c89319e719c8b579e57dac86ca94cf52dd059dc6a
spent
true